any racing shocks/struts?
 
fron www.zilvia.net, i saw that the highest spring rate for a spring was the kgmm (dr21 racing?) with 6.6/5.2 spring rate. now i was wondering if there were any shocks sold domestically that can handle these spring rates.

the kyb agx can only handle 50% more than stock spec, which is a shame b/c i had my heart set on those.

i think koni (yellow?) can handle the rsr race springs... can anyone verify this? if they can, i will just have to settle for that setup because i doubt that there is any strut/shock that can handle the kgmm's

whizbang18T 01-18-2004 11:53 AM

where did read about the kyb agx's only handling up to 50% more than stock spec? 50% more what exactly? i'm just unclear of what you're trying to achieve ... to my understanding, shocks are simply for dampening, right? your car doesn't sit on the shox - the springs carry the majority of the load. so i'm a little confused why the agx's "can't handle" the kgmms? i think what should be kept in mind is ride height & pre-load on the dampeners (shocks) ...
